    This was soooo yummy! Two things I did different ... I used more than a teaspoon of essence; 1.5 tablespoons to be exact for the meat. I also used part of the beef stock to de-glaze the pan after browning the meat and mix it with the rest of the beef stock. This was soooo tasty on a cold winter night .. mmmMMmMMMMmM!!     The recipe is good, but the directions should be more clear. After the first hour on high, turn down the cooker to low setting for the remaining 7 hours. Also, I think the mushrooms should be added towards the end, since they appeared over-cooked after 8 hours in the cooker. It also could use a little more flour to help thicken it. Lastly, it needed a little more seasoning.
